"This traditional double bay fronted semi detached home is situated in the popular location of The Headlands. The property has been refurbished by the current owners since their purchase eight years ago to include replacement double glazing throughout, a new central heating system and re-wiring. The accommodation comprises an open plan lounge/dining room, re-fitted kitchen, three bedrooms and a family bathroom. Outside there is off road parking to the front for two vehicles and the 60 foot south facing rear garden is mainly laid to lawn.

ACCOMMODATION GROUND FLOOR ENTRANCE HALL Approached by double doors, the hall contains the stairs rising to the first floor with storage below housing the gas meter and electrical fusebox and cloaks hanging space. Doors to:- LOUNGE/DINER 25'11 x 11'11 (7.90m x 3.63m) An open plan room with a bay window to the front and double doors leading to the rear patio with a window to the side. There is a feature fireplace with inset gas fire and wood mantel, exposed floorboards and coving to ceiling. DINING AREA With a built-in cupboard with glazed storage above and coving to ceiling. KITCHEN 10'3 x 7'4 (3.12m x 2.24m) Accessed from both the dining room and hallway, the kitchen has been re-fitted with a range of base and eye level cabinets with work surfaces incorporating a stainless steel sink and drainer with mixer tap over. Appliances include a four ring gas hob with double oven below and extractor above. Space is provided for a fridge/freezer and a utility area provides space for a dishwasher and washing machine. There are spotlights to ceiling, a window to the rear and a door to the side. LEAN-TO Which provides access from the front to the kitchen. FIRST FLOOR LANDING With a window to the side and doors to:- BEDROOM ONE 12'10 x 9'11 (3.91m x 3.02m) With a bay window to the front elevation, there are two double wardrobes and a TV point. BEDROOM TWO 11' x 9'9 (3.35m x 2.97m) With a window to the rear and built-in double storage. BEDROOM THREE 7'10 x 6'7 (2.39m x 2.01m) With a window to the front. FAMILY BATHROOM 6'6 x 6'1 (1.98m x 1.85m) Fitted with a suite comprising a panelled bath with Mira power shower over, pedestal wash hand basin and WC. There is a tiled floor and tiling to splashbacks, a heated towel rail and a window to the rear. OUTSIDE FRONT Fully paved and providing off road parking for two vehicles and access to the side. REAR GARDEN The south facing garden is mainly laid to lawn with flower and shrub borders and a pathway leading to the rear. SERVICES Main drainage, gas, water and electricity are connected. Central heating is through radiators from a gas fired boiler which also provides the domestic hot water. The property benefits from PVCu double glazing throughout. There are TV and telephone connections, continuation of which are subject to the usual supplier regulations. (None of these services has been tested). LOCAL AMENITIES There is a selection of stores including a Post Office, Convenience Store, Newsagents and Mini Market in Bushland Road. A bus service to and from Northampton Town Centre runs from the Wellingborough Road and local schools include Weston Favell Primary School, Headlands Primary School in Bushland Road and secondary education at Weston Favell School in Booth Lane South. The Weston Favell Shopping Centre is approximately one mile away. Motorway access is via Rushmere Road and then Nene Valley Way to Junction 15.
